Liu Sanjie information

Film Liu Sanjie is a folk legend of the Zhuang people, ancient folklore singer, intelligent and sensitive, singing like a spring, beautiful and moving, has the "song fairy" reputation. People are immensely fond of Liu Sanjie, about her stories and records a lot, but also in the March 3 every year as a holiday to commemorate her.

In 2006, Guangxi Zhuang Autonomous Region, Yizhou City, declared "Liu Sanjie ballad", selected as one of the first batch of national intangible cultural heritage list, the category of folklore projects, serial number 23. After the national examination and research decision: Yizhou City as Liu Sanjie hometown.

Related Legends

Strong Singer The story of Liu Sanjie is mainly circulated in the Zhuang compatriot settlement in Guangxi. In Xiashan Village on the banks of the Xiashan River in western Guangxi, there lived a young girl surnamed Liu with the breast name Shanhua, who was called Liu Sanjie because of her line of three.

Liu Sanjie was especially fond of singing mountain songs, and the young men who came from a hundred miles around were famous for singing songs with her, and none of them could win. When the landlord Mo Huairen exploited the peasants in Mo Village, Liu Sanjie sang songs to expose his ugly behavior. In order to prevent Liu Sanjie from singing the song, Mo Huairen used all sorts of vile tactics, causing Liu Sanjie to lose her footing and fall into the water, drifting to the Seven Star Rock in Guilin.

Legend has it that Liu Sanjie sang for seven days and seven nights with a young man who guarded the rice mill at the Seven Star Rock and then flew away as a pair of yellow warblers." March 3", is the largest song polder in the Zhuang region, also known as the "Songxian Festival", is said to be in honor of Liu Sanjie and the formation of folk commemorative festivals.
